Alibaba Cloud Linux怎么安装图形操作界面?

云计算

Alibaba Cloud Linux安装图形操作界面指南

结论与核心观点

在Alibaba Cloud Linux上安装图形界面(GUI)是可行的,但需要权衡性能与资源消耗。这里提供两种主流方法:GNOME和Xfce桌面环境的安装步骤,推荐服务器环境下谨慎使用GUI,仅当确实需要时再安装。

安装前的准备

  • 确认系统版本:执行cat /etc/os-release查看具体版本
  • 更新系统:先运行sudo yum update -y确保系统最新
  • 检查内存:GUI至少需要1GB内存(推荐2GB+),使用free -h查看

方法一:安装GNOME桌面环境(较重量级)

  1. 安装GNOME核心组件

    sudo yum groupinstall "GNOME Desktop" -y
  2. 设置默认启动目标

    sudo systemctl set-default graphical.target
  3. 安装必要工具

    sudo yum install -y xrdp
    sudo systemctl start xrdp
    sudo systemctl enable xrdp
  4. 重启系统

    sudo reboot

注意:GNOME占用资源较多,适合配置较高的云服务器。

方法二:安装Xfce桌面环境(轻量级推荐)

  1. 安装EPEL仓库

    sudo yum install -y epel-release
  2. 安装Xfce核心组件

    sudo yum groupinstall "Xfce" -y
  3. 安装远程桌面服务

    sudo yum install -y xrdp
    sudo systemctl start xrdp
    sudo systemctl enable xrdp
  4. 配置Xfce为默认会话

    echo "xfce4-session" > ~/.Xclients
    chmod +x ~/.Xclients
  5. 重启服务

    sudo systemctl restart xrdp

优势:Xfce资源占用低,适合云服务器环境。

连接图形界面

  • Windows用户:使用"远程桌面连接"(mstsc)
  • Mac/Linux用户:使用Remmina或其他RDP客户端
  • 连接地址:服务器公网IP:3389

常见问题解决

  • 黑屏问题:尝试修改/etc/xrdp/xrdp.ini中的max_bpp=24
  • 中文显示异常:安装中文字体sudo yum install -y wqy-*
  • 分辨率问题:在RDP客户端中设置合适的分辨率

安全建议

  • 限制访问IP:配置安全组只允许特定IP访问3389端口
  • 使用SSH隧道:更安全的连接方式
  • 定期更新:保持xrdp和桌面环境为最新版本

卸载图形界面(如需恢复)

  1. 卸载GNOME:

    sudo yum groupremove "GNOME Desktop"
  2. 卸载Xfce:

    sudo yum groupremove "Xfce"
  3. 恢复默认启动:

    sudo systemctl set-default multi-user.target

最终建议

对于Alibaba Cloud Linux服务器,除非必要,否则不建议安装图形界面。大多数管理任务可通过SSH和命令行工具高效完成。如需临时使用GUI,可考虑X11转发或Web版管理工具如Cockpit(sudo yum install -y cockpit)。

未经允许不得转载:CLOUD云枢 » Alibaba Cloud Linux怎么安装图形操作界面?